Choosing the correct motor base defines your project's longevity. Brushed DC Planetary Motors provide excellent starting torque and cost-effective operation under intermittent cycles (e.g., smart home locks, vending actuators). Conversely, Brushless DC (BLDC) Planetary Motors utilize electronic commutation, eliminating brush friction to guarantee operational lifespans beyond 10,000 hours, minimal EMI noise, and precise variable speed control via integrated hall-effect sensors.

High-torque N20 planetary gear motors are widely used in smart door locks. Their compact size allows for easy integration into slim handles, while the high gear reduction ratio provides the torque needed to throw heavy deadbolts reliably.
From robotic vacuum drive wheels and rotating brushes to automated navigation lidar mechanisms, our compact brushless and brushed planetary solutions ensure quiet, maintenance-free operation over long service lives.
Micro planetary drives are utilized in automated pipettes, surgical instruments, and fluid dosing pumps. They ensure steady flow control and precise rotational positioning in sensitive medical environments.
Emerging technologies shaping the next generation of gear motors.
As automation becomes more decentralized, planetary motors are increasingly integrated with high-resolution magnetic or optical encoders. This allows for closed-loop control, giving robotics real-time positioning feedback with minimal bulk.
As BLDC drivers become more cost-effective, applications traditionally using brushed motors are transitioning to brushless planetary drives. This migration drastically reduces maintenance costs and electromagnetic interference (EMI).
By pairing high-strength metal output gears with self-lubricating POM (Polyoxymethylene) plastic gears on the initial high-speed stages, manufacturers can reduce acoustic noise levels below 40dB without sacrificing total torque output.
